How improved sleep boosts motivation and focus

Sleep is often overlooked as a cornerstone of wellness and personal productivity. In our fast-paced world, where the hustle is celebrated, quality sleep might not seem like a priority. However, recent studies have demonstrated that improved sleep can significantly boost motivation and focus, serving as an essential factor in achieving both personal and professional goals.

When we sleep, our bodies go through various cycles that are crucial for mental and physical restoration. The deep sleep phase, for instance, is vital for memory consolidation, learning, and cognitive function. During this time, the brain processes information from the day, strengthens neural connections, and clears out toxins. This restorative aspect of sleep leads to better cognitive performance when we’re awake, enhancing our ability to concentrate and stay focused on tasks.

Inadequate sleep, on the other hand, can lead to cognitive impairment, decreased motivation, and an overall lack of energy. When you wake up groggy and unrested, your mental clarity diminishes. Simple tasks can feel overwhelming, and motivation wanes as lethargy sets in. Studies have shown that sleep deprivation can negatively affect mood, leading to irritability and stress, which further decreases our willingness to engage in challenging tasks.

Improved sleep can enhance motivation in two significant ways: by boosting energy levels and improving mood. Restorative sleep allows the body and mind to recharge. When you wake up feeling refreshed, you’re more likely to approach your day with a can-do attitude, ready to tackle your to-do list. This elevated energy level can spark motivation to start new projects, pursue goals, or even engage in physical activities that enhance well-being.

Moreover, sleep plays a crucial role in emotional regulation. When you’re well-rested, you have a better handle on your emotions and face challenges with a positive mindset. Conversely, sleep deprivation can lead to increased anxiety and difficulty handling stressors, which in turn diminishes motivation. Improving sleep habits can lead to a more positive emotional landscape, fostering resilience and the determination to pursue goals.

Additionally, the relationship between sleep, focus, and productivity cannot be overstated. When you sleep well, your brain functions more efficiently, leading to improved concentration and better decision-making capabilities. This can be particularly important in environments that demand multitasking or quick thinking. In a work setting, for example, employees who enjoy regular, restorative sleep are more productive, make fewer mistakes, and demonstrate enhanced attention to detail.

To cultivate improved sleep, consider establishing a regular sleep schedule, creating a comfortable sleep environment, and adopting relaxation techniques such as meditation or reading before bed. Limiting caffeine intake and screen time in the hours leading up to sleep can also significantly impact the quality of your rest.
